What Is a Heat-Resistant Silicone VMQ O-Ring?
A VMQ O-Ring, also known as a Silicone O-Ring or MVQ O-Ring, is a circular elastomer seal manufactured from high-performance silicone rubber (VMQ). Unlike conventional rubber materials, VMQ silicone maintains excellent elasticity at both high and low temperatures, making it one of the most widely used sealing materials across multiple industries.
Its silicon-oxygen molecular structure gives VMQ outstanding thermal stability, excellent flexibility, and long-term resistance to environmental aging.
Heat-Resistant Silicone VMQ O-Rings are commonly selected for applications requiring:
- Continuous high-temperature operation
- Outdoor weather resistance
- Excellent UV and ozone resistance
- Low compression set
- Electrical insulation
- Food-grade and medical-grade sealing
- Long service life with minimal maintenance
Why Choose Heat-Resistant Silicone VMQ O-Rings?
Outstanding High Temperature Resistance
VMQ silicone remains flexible over an exceptionally wide operating temperature range.
Standard compounds operate continuously from -40°C to +250°C, while specially formulated grades can withstand intermittent temperatures up to 300°C, depending on the application.
This makes VMQ O-rings ideal for equipment exposed to continuous heating, thermal cycling, steam, and hot air.
Excellent Flexibility at Low Temperatures
Unlike many elastomers that harden in cold environments, silicone rubber retains excellent flexibility even below freezing.
This allows reliable sealing in refrigeration systems, outdoor equipment, aerospace components, and cold-climate machinery.
Excellent Weather and Ozone Resistance
Silicone rubber naturally resists:
- UV radiation
- Ozone
- Oxygen
- Rain
- Humidity
- Outdoor aging
Even after years of outdoor exposure, VMQ O-rings maintain their elasticity without cracking or becoming brittle.

Technical Specifications
| Property | Specification |
|---|---|
| Product Name | Heat-Resistant Silicone VMQ O-Ring |
| Material | VMQ Silicone Rubber |
| Standard Hardness | 60, 70, 90 Shore A |
| Custom Hardness | 30–80 Shore A |
| Working Temperature | -40°C to +250°C |
| Maximum Short-Term Temperature | Up to +300°C |
| Working Pressure | Depends on groove design and application |
| Standard Colors | Red, White, Transparent |
| Custom Colors | Black, Blue, Green, Orange, Gray and others |
| Standard Sizes | AS568, ISO 3601, JIS, Metric |
| Custom Sizes | Available |
| Manufacturing Process | Compression Molding / Injection Molding |
| Certifications | ISO 9001, FDA, LFGB, RoHS, REACH (Material Dependent) |
Typical Physical Properties
| Property | Typical Value |
|---|---|
| Tensile Strength | 8–11 MPa |
| Elongation at Break | 350–700% |
| Compression Set | Excellent |
| Tear Strength | High |
| UV Resistance | Excellent |
| Ozone Resistance | Excellent |
| Weather Resistance | Excellent |
| Electrical Insulation | Excellent |
Actual values depend on compound formulation and hardness.

What does VMQ mean?
VMQ is the international material designation for silicone rubber. It is widely recognized for its excellent heat resistance, flexibility, weather resistance, and electrical insulation.
What temperature can Heat-Resistant Silicone VMQ O-Rings withstand?
Standard VMQ O-rings operate continuously between -40°C and +250°C. Special formulations can tolerate short-term exposure up to 300°C, depending on the application.
